    Saudi Arabia Suspends 2 Umrah Agencies Over Accommodation Lapse for Pilgrims

    Saudi Arabia has suspended two Umrah travel agencies after they failed to arrange proper accommodation for pilgrims arriving from Egypt. Authorities confirmed that strict action was taken against the companies and their local agents for not meeting service requirements. The affected pilgrims were later provided with suitable lodging to ensure their comfort and safety.

    The decision comes shortly after a wider crackdown in which around 1,800 foreign Umrah agencies were suspended due to poor service standards and violations of regulations. Saudi officials said they closely monitor every stage of a pilgrim’s journey, from visa processing and airport arrival to transportation and hotel arrangements, to make sure everything runs smoothly.

    Authorities also emphasized that only approved and licensed hotels can be used for Umrah bookings. Travel agencies that offer visa-only packages without arranging proper services risk suspension and legal action. The government has reiterated its commitment to maintaining high standards to protect pilgrims and improve their overall experience.
